Shelby Jean Hanson of Westerville, Ohio was born on May 6, 1944 in Warren, Ohio and passed away on March 18, 2023. Although born in Warren, the family moved to Erie, PA in 1947 where she lived until 1965. She is proceeded in death by her mother Jean Donato, father James Olson, stepfather Al Donato, sister Carol, nieces and nephews. She is survived by her husband of 58 years, Paul Hanson, her daughter and son-in-law Kirsten and Jason Hoffman, three grandchildren Nathan, Audrey and Juliet Hoffman, sister Tina Phillips, nieces and nephews.

She and her husband Paul met in high school when she was 16 and he was 18. After 4 years of dating and engagement they were married on January 3, 1965 at St. John's Church in Erie, PA. She was an avid reader and excelled at cross stitch. While living in Chagrin Falls, Ohio, her local frame shop requested the okay to hang her framed cross stitch works so people could see what a finished piece should look like. A special occasion that was enjoyed each Friday night, with long time friends, was getting together for dinner and conversation at a local restaurant. This gathering with as many as 20 friends was called "Fricc". 

She enjoyed 35 years of summer trips to Lake Cumberland, KY with friends renting houseboats and relaxing on the lake. Highlights in the last 15 years were led by family vacations to the Outer Banks and Rehoboth for quality time with grandchildren and extended family.  She also enjoyed trips with good friends to Hocking Hills to rent cabins and enjoy good food, wine and Trivial Pursuit.  Her extensive knowledge of trivia added to many fun nights of Trivial Pursuit with family.  She was also a long time card player who enjoyed Pinochle, Canasta, Yuchre, Bridge and even a quick game of Pickle.  

She was able to ascertain the special qualities in each of her grandchildren and always be there for a long talk of helpful advice.  She could be depended on to have a smile and encouraging word for family and friends and will be missed by all.
